Grateful to be in a Box

So, I was minding my own business today, taking care of business around the camp before heading to our local Log base to pick up my new Humvee.  More to follow on that!  So, nice and sunny until we got ready to leave then it blew in.  Holy scheizer!  By the time we got back tonight the winds had kicked up to the point that the tin was pulling off the roof of the shelters separating the shipping containers that we live in.  The tin was coming off with enough force to cut someone in half....not kidding.  So, I'm glad to live in a shipping container and not in the wooden huts like the enlisted guys!  I'm not so sure that one of those things couldn't shear the plywood they live in.  Now if I could do something about the water leaking all over my friggin room!
Yes, We went to pick up another Humvee today.  After the whole signing your life away thing, I walked over to one of the other officers from Georgia and told him I felt like a teenager getting his first car, but with a .50 cal and SAW (sqaud automatic weapon) to boot!  As I turned to walk away (close your ears mom) I said "It's time for me to get the *(&^ out of this country!  When a guy gets jittery over a new 1151, its just time to get out!"  
I'll let you know if our entire shelter blows away.  Who knows, I may wake up in Kansas tomorrow!
